National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H) sponsors 343 registered US clinical trials on ClinicalTrials.gov, 42 of them currently recruiting, and 256 completed. 29 of these trials are in Phase 3-4 (later-stage) and 106 in Phase 1-2 (earlier-stage). The most-studied condition in this pipeline is Healthy, with 21 trials.

Trial completion reliability score
256 of 296 decided trials (Completed vs. Terminated on ClinicalTrials.gov) reached their planned completion (86.5%), vs. national p10 68.4% / p90 100% among 1,234 sponsors with at least 10 decided trials. Still-open trials (Recruiting, Active-not-recruiting, Not-yet-recruiting) are excluded since they have not reached an outcome yet.
